The Hidden Cost of Translation Gaps
Every year, thousands of products get delayed or scrapped because the prototyping partner didn’t understand design language. Surface breaks become stress risers. CMF transitions turn into assembly nightmares. Ergonomic curves lose their magic when draft angles are ignored.
A true Professional Prototype Company prevents this by embedding design fluency into every engineering decision. Not after the prototype fails—from the very first DFM review.

Three Prototypes, One Design-Led Workflow
Not every prototype serves the same purpose. A Professional Prototype Company that speaks designer language builds with intentionality:
• Digital 3D (for licensing & pitch): High-impact visuals to validate product concepts early, perfect for stakeholder buy-in.
• Functional Prototype (for testing & validation): Working prototypes built for real-world testing—thermal, mechanical, and user experience validation under actual conditions.
• Production-Intent (for mass production): Engineered from day one for tooling readiness. Real materials, scalable structures, and factory-approval ready.
